As they launch their spring 2020 touring season with the Only Jesus Tour this week, GRAMMY-Award® winning and multi-RIAA Platinum®-selling Christian music group Casting Crowns celebrates a highly successful 2019. It has been nearly two decades since the group’s label debut and Casting Crowns continues to achieve career milestones through numerous chart-topping hits and touring that drives their music consumption to position them as one of the top-performing Christian artists today and in the history of Christian music.
Paul Baloche recently released his latest album, Behold Him. Creating music for more than 25 years, Baloche's Behold Him is his 22nd career album and features numerous guest collaborations from industry friends such as Kim Walker-Smith of Jesus Culture, Kari Jobe, Matt Redman, Elevation Worship's Chris Brown and Steve Furtick, Leslie Jordan of All Sons & Daughters, Amanda Cook, and more. Full of reverence, thankfulness, and trust in God's provision and presence, Behold Him delivers an impactful message important for all believers.
From executive producers and Grammy Award winners Queen Latifah, Mary J. Blige and Missy Elliott, comes the authorized musical tale of the incomparable gospel singers, The Clark Sisters. The Clark Sisters: First Ladies of Gospel recounts the story of the highest selling female gospel group in history and of their trailblazing mother, Mattie Moss Clark (Aunjanue Ellis).
